Output 5e97808faa7d0f56ceccf8e5c2df64ea6dbafd2391a83e29ab133ba40c2d0dc3:25

value
159406
script pubkey
OP_0 OP_PUSHBYTES_20 da43f79f0de80ef494e10d4f44c42a982d2cf868
address
bc1qmfpl08cdaq80f98pp485f3p2nqkje7rgszy7sh
transaction
5e97808faa7d0f56ceccf8e5c2df64ea6dbafd2391a83e29ab133ba40c2d0dc3